The Goethe Certificate: A Gateway to German Language Proficiency
The Goethe Certificate, likewise called the Goethe-Zertifikat, is an internationally recognized certification that evaluates and accredits proficiency in the German language. Administered by the Goethe-Institut, the world's biggest German cultural organization, these certificates are developed to provide a standardized procedure of German language abilities for various levels, from novices to innovative speakers. This post explores the significance of the Goethe Certificate, its various levels, the evaluation procedure, and its advantages for personal and professional advancement.
What is the Goethe Certificate?
The Goethe Certificate is a series of language proficiency tests that align with the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R). The CEFR is a framework used to explain language ability on a six-point scale, varying from A1 (novice) to C2 (efficiency). The Goethe Certificate is acknowledged by universities, employers, and federal governments worldwide, making it an important property for anybody wanting to demonstrate their German language skills.
Levels of the Goethe Certificate
The Goethe Certificate is divided into several levels, each corresponding to a particular CEFR level:

Goethe-Zertifikat A1: Start Deutsch 1
Description: This certificate is designed for beginners and confirms that the holder can interact in basic and routine jobs needing a basic and direct exchange of details.Skills: Understanding and using familiar everyday expressions, fundamental phrases, and introducing oneself and others.
Goethe-Zertifikat A2: Start Deutsch 2
Description: This level verifies that the holder can understand sentences and regularly utilized expressions associated to locations of a lot of immediate relevance (e.g., individual and family info, shopping, regional geography, employment).Skills: Communicating in simple and routine tasks, explaining in basic terms aspects of their background, instant environment, and matters in areas of immediate need.
Goethe-Zertifikat B1
Description: This certificate confirms that the holder can understand the main points of clear standard input on familiar matters routinely come across in work, school, leisure, and so on.Abilities: Dealing with a lot of circumstances likely to develop while taking a trip in a German-speaking location, and producing simple connected text on subjects that recognize or of personal interest.
Goethe-Zertifikat B2
Description: This level validates that the holder can comprehend the main points of complicated text on both concrete and abstract topics, consisting of technical discussions in his/her field of expertise.Skills: Interacting with a degree of fluency and spontaneity that makes regular interaction with native speakers rather possible without pressure for either celebration, and producing clear, comprehensive text on a large range of topics.
Goethe-GöThe zertifikat C1
Description: This certificate confirms that the holder can comprehend a vast array of requiring, longer texts and acknowledge implicit significance.Abilities: Expressing him/herself with complete confidence and spontaneously without much apparent looking for expressions, and utilizing language flexibly and effectively for social, scholastic, and expert purposes.
Goethe-Zertifikat C2: Großes Deutsches Sprachdiplom
Description: This is the highest level of the Goethe Certificate and verifies that the holder can comprehend with ease virtually whatever heard or read.Skills: Summarizing information from various spoken and composed sources, rebuilding arguments and accounts in a coherent discussion, and revealing him/herself spontaneously, really with complete confidence, and precisely, distinguishing finer tones of meaning even in more complex circumstances.The Examination Process
The Goethe Certificate assessments are designed to evaluate all 4 language abilities: reading, writing, listening, and speaking. Each level has a specific format and duration, but normally, the examinations consist of:
Reading Comprehension: Multiple-choice concerns, gap-filling exercises, and short-answer concerns.Writing: Tasks such as composing a letter, an essay, or a report.Listening Comprehension: Multiple-choice concerns, gap-filling exercises, and short-answer questions based upon tape-recorded texts.Speaking: Oral interviews or role-plays with an examiner.Preparation for the Goethe Certificate

Q: How long does it take to get ready for the Goethe Certificate?A: The preparation time varies depending on the individual's starting level and the level they are going for. Generally, it can take several months to a year of consistent study.

Q: Can I take the Goethe Certificate exam online?A: Yes, the Goethe-Institut uses online versions of a few of its examinations. However, the accessibility and format might differ, so it's finest to check the official website for the most present information.

Q: What is the passing rating for the Goethe Certificate?A: The passing score varies by level, however generally, you require to attain a minimum of 60-70% in each section of the exam to pass.

Q: Can I retake the exam if I fail?A: Yes, you can retake the exam. There is no limitation to the number of times you can attempt the exam, however you will require to pay the exam charge each time.

Q: Is the Goethe Certificate valid for life?A: Yes, the Goethe Certificate stands for life. As soon as you pass the exam, your certificate remains legitimate forever.
